Sunday, March 09, 2008

Front end design

I just spent the weekend with the BView team ironing out bugs for the launch of the site. Startups are startups and this is only the 3rd weekend of working on the project so I am reasonably happy to do the time.

As ever, the things that are left to last are front end as:
  • everyone has an opinion
  • you see something in HTML form, play with it, and you don't like it
  • you completely underestimate how long it takes to code the front end
  • the front end is always full of regression errors
  • Microsoft browsers always screw you somehow
Some stats around one week to launch:

functional bugs: ~30
front end bugs: ~250

My advice to anyone still thinking on the front end:

  • keep it simple
  • always UAT the front end for the lowest common denominator (of browser/OS not User intelligence)
  • keep it simple
You can always over elaborate once you are live!

No comments: